About 3-bromo-5-[butyl(methyl)amino]benzoic acid
3-bromo-5-[butyl(methyl)amino]benzoic acid (PubChem CID 102822651) has the molecular formula C12H16BrNO2
and a molecular weight of 286.17 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-bromo-5-[butyl(methyl)amino]benzoic acid.
